**Ticket VX-441:** Plugin submissions failing signature verification against the Corvid public API since the pagination overhaul. Cursor params changed; old signed manifests reference deprecated `page` fields, so checksums mismatch. Regenerate your manifest against schema v5 and re-sign. Verification requires the current registry signing key, listed below.

deploy key for kahof-tadup: bky4_rRMZ

**Vendor note: Inkmill markdown pipeline**

Rendering for Parchway docs is outsourced to Inkmill under an annual contract, renewing each March. They handle sanitization and PDF export; we own the upload queue. SLA: 4-hour response on rendering failures. Escalate only after two failed retries. Their support desk is reachable at the address below.

billing contact of hahaf-baguf = zorael.tammir.jorius@sivrelhq.internal

Hey Marit,

Handing over the Quillfox release duty. Heads up: the autocomplete index on search-suggest has been rebuilding slowly since Tuesday — queries over 400ms at peak. Danil bumped the shard count but it needs watching. If you have to push the hotfix build, sign it before promoting to prod. Here's the deploy key you'll need:

release key, fajef-kajeg: bky19_LdLu6Ne6FLi8he2c24d

Dear team assistants, please note that the shuttle-bus gate on the Harrowmede Campus west side now operates on a timed schedule: it opens ten minutes before each departure and closes promptly afterwards. If you are escorting guests to the shuttle, arrive early and remain with them until boarding. Out-of-hours access requires manual entry at the keypad beside the gate. The current gate code is below.

turnstile pass: bdg-YPPQB-52010